Transaction 0372757b250fc5851eae3c7183326cde260d92c0a6eef8fe56b236d4cdd48a43

2 Input
2 Outputs
  • 0372757b250fc5851eae3c7183326cde260d92c0a6eef8fe56b236d4cdd48a43:0
  • value  81680
    address  3JLZ41Sro5MQ23WkkwJyJDLc2QnkDfDDrQ
  • 0372757b250fc5851eae3c7183326cde260d92c0a6eef8fe56b236d4cdd48a43:1
  • value  1061820
    address  339H7P8Uvw9biNeRpMtA1ShwWtMyLGfVMn